Where to Use the Design Carefully

While the “Plaid Christmas Bow” embroidery design is versatile, there are areas where caution is needed. Small chest placements may require adjusting the size to avoid overcrowding. Dense stitch areas could cause fabric puckering, so using the right stabilizer is crucial. When working with stretchy fabrics like fleece or ribbed material, ensure the design is properly hoop-mounted to prevent distortion.

On curved surfaces or garments with tiny lettering, the detail might not translate perfectly. Always test the design on scrap fabric before applying it to your final product. Also, check the thread color contrast to make sure it complements the garment’s base color. If the design includes small text, confirm that it remains legible after embroidery.

Embroidery Designer Notes: Pre-Production Checklist

Before finalizing your project, always test the “Plaid Christmas Bow” embroidery design on scrap fabric. This helps identify any issues with stitch density or fabric texture. Check the hoop size required for the design to ensure it fits your machine. Confirm the stabilizer type that works best for your chosen fabric, especially if you're working with stretchy or delicate materials.

Review the thread colors included in the embroidery file to make sure they match your intended look. If the design requires specific thread shades, verify that they’re available or consider alternatives. Lastly, check Creative Fabrica product details and licensing terms to ensure you’re allowed to sell finished apparel featuring this design.
